Build software that combines Python??? s expressivity with the performance and control of C (and C++). It??? s possible with Cython, the compiler and hybrid programming language used by foundational packages such as NumPy, and prominent in projects including Pandas, h5py, and scikits-learn. In this practical guide, you??? ll learn how to use Cython to improve Python??? s performance??? up to 3000x??? and to wrap C and C++ libraries in Python with ease. Author Kurt Smith takes you through Cython??? s capabilities, with sample code and in-depth practice exercises. If you??? re just starting with Cython, or want to go deeper, you??? ll learn how this language is an essential part of any performance-oriented Python programmer??? s arsenal. Use Cython??? s static typing to speed up Python code Gain hands-on experience using Cython features to boost your numeric-heavy Python Create new types with Cython??? and see how fast object-oriented programming in Python can be Effectively organize Cython code into separate modules and packages without sacrificing performance Use Cython to give Pythonic interfaces to C and C++ libraries Optimize code with Cython??? s runtime and compile-time profiling tools Use Cython??? s prange function to parallelize loops transparently with OpenMP
